Suzanne Von Borsody
Suzanne von Borsody (; born 23 September 1957 in Munich) is a German actress. She comes from a prominent theatre family, being the daughter of actress Rosemarie Fendel and actor Hans von Borsody. Her grandfather, Eduard von Borsody, was a famous director, while his brother, her great uncle, Julius von Borsody, was an equally famous set designer. She may be best known internationally for playing Frau Jäger in the 1998 film '' Run Lola Run'', and has also done dubbing work for foreign films such as ''Treasure Planet'', where she provides the German voice of Captain Amelia. She is a Goodwill Ambassador for UNICEF as well as for several other charity organizations. Starting Over (2007 Film)
''Starting Over'' is a 2007 Scottish romantic drama television film directed by Giles Foster, produced by the British company Gate Television Productions for the German television channel Zweites Deutsches Fernsehen (ZDF). Based on the 2002 novel of the same name by Robin Pilcher, the film stars Suzanne von Borsody, Iain Glen and Rutger Hauer. Plot summary The film explores how an aristocratic woman's life changes when her brother dies and her marriage breaks down. Lady Elizabeth Dewhurst (Suzanne von Borsody) believes her husband Gregor (Iain Glen) is at fault for the accidental death of her beloved brother Simon ( William Mickleburgh). Their marriage has been rocky, but this is the last straw and she asks him to move out of the household. Elizabeth's best friend Mary Phillips ( Rachel Fielding) has had her eye on Gregor for some time and sees this as her chance. Leo & Claire
''Leo & Claire'' (german: Leo und Claire) is a 2001 German historical drama film produced, written and directed by Joseph Vilsmaier and starring Michael Degen and Suzanne von Borsody. The film was competing at the Montreal World Film Festival on 27 August 2001. Plot Nuremberg, 1933. Leo Katzenberger, a Jewish businessman, runs a shoe business from his flat. He loves his wife Claire, as well as their daughters, and other family members. It all seems to be that nothing can ruin their life together, until blond beauty Irene Scheffler, a model, decides to open a photography studio next to him. As time goes by, Irene and Leo start to get closer, resulting in a cosy and platonic friendship. Due to his failure to be discreet in his affair, Leo is arrested, tried and then executed in a process that became known as the Katzenberger Trial.
